Calibration points

Calibration can be performed using one, two or three buffer solutions in
any order (single-point-, two-point or three-point calibration). The meter
determines the following values and calculates the calibration line as
follows:

You can display the slope in the unit, mV/pH or % (see section 4.6.4).

AutoRead

The calibration procedure automatically activates the AutoRead func-
tion.
The current AutoRead measurement can be terminated at any time
(accepting the current value).

Calibration record

When finishing a calibration, the new calibration values are displayed
as an informative message (

i

symbol) first. Then you can decide

whether you want to take over these values of the new calibration or
whether you want to continue measuring with the old calibration data.
After accepting the new calibration values the calibration record is dis-
played.

Displaying and down-

loading calibration data

to interface

You can view the data of the last calibration on the display. Subse-
quently, you can download the displayed calibration data to the inter-
face, e. g. to a PC, with the <PRT> key.

The calibration record of the last calibration can be found under the
Configuration / pH & ORP / Calibration / Calibration record menu item.
